Vantara Animal Kingdom: A New Era of Wildlife Care and Conservation in India
Vantara Animal Kingdom is redefining wildlife care, rescue, and rehabilitation in India. Founded under the visionary leadership of Anant Ambani, …
Vantara Animal Kingdom is redefining wildlife care, rescue, and rehabilitation in India. Founded under the visionary leadership of Anant Ambani, …